Centralising information and open data about public contracting
Bojonegoro Institute
- Country (or countries) of implementation: Indonesia
Year when project started:
2016
Year when project ended:
Still ongoing
Project’s main objectives and results:
The project aims to address the low level of civil society involvement in implementation of goods and services procurement within the Government of Bojonegoro, Indonesia. Lack of public access to the procurement process, makes it difficult to control for irregularities and corruption in procurement. The project wants to create centralised information and open data about public contracting to encourage citizen feedback and improve responsiveness and accountability of civil servants in Bojonegoro.
